IMA Life has announced its support in Sharp Sterile Manufacturing's $28m expansion of its Lee, Massachusetts, facility.
The investment includes the installation of a fully automated IMA Life isolated filling line for Ready-To-Use vials, marking a significant milestone in advancing sterile manufacturing capabilities in the US.
The new system integrates cutting-edge robotics, non-destructive weight checks and a state-of-the-art lyophiliser, enabling Sharp Sterile to produce batches of up to 100,000 units efficiently.
By more than doubling the site’s filling capacity, this technology will help pharmaceutical partners accelerate the delivery of critical therapies to patients worldwide.
